U.S. Infrastructure Improves, but Cuts May Imperil Progress, Report Says

Elevated federal spending in recent times has helped to enhance U.S. ports, roads, parks, public transit and levees, in keeping with a report launched on Tuesday by the American Society of Civil Engineers.

However that progress may stagnate if these investments, a few of which had been placed on maintain after President Trump took workplace in January, aren’t sustained.

General, the group gave the nation’s infrastructure a C grade, a mediocre ranking however the perfect the nation has acquired because the group’s first report card in 1998. Most infrastructure, together with aviation, waterways and colleges, earned a C or D grade; ports and rail did higher. The group additionally projected a $3.7 trillion infrastructure funding shortfall over the following decade.

“The report card demonstrates the essential want for the brand new administration and Congress to proceed sustained funding in infrastructure,” Darren Olson, the chairman of the society’s committee on America’s infrastructure, stated on a name with reporters. “Higher infrastructure is an environment friendly funding of taxpayer {dollars} that leads to a stronger economic system and prioritizes American jobs.”

The report, which is now launched each 4 years, has lengthy famous that america spends too little on infrastructure. However that began to vary in 2021, the group stated, because of the Infrastructure Funding and Jobs Act, which licensed $1.2 trillion in funding below President Joseph R. Biden Jr. That funding is exhibiting outcomes, with grades having improved because the final report, in 2021, for practically half the 18 classes that the group tracks.

However in January, Mr. Trump froze a lot of the funding below that legislation and one other geared toward addressing local weather change, pending a evaluate by his businesses. That halted a variety of programs, together with these meant to assist colleges, farmers and small companies.

The engineering group expressed optimism that the federal spending would finally proceed as a result of it benefited most People and loved bipartisan help.

“The funding ranges that we noticed below the final administration have actually began to maneuver the needle, and we’re trying ahead to advancing that dialog as we transfer into this administration,” stated Kristina Swallow, a former president of the group.

The nation’s ports acquired the best grade of any type of infrastructure, a B, indicating that they’re typically secure, dependable and in good situation. Rail acquired a B–, a decline from its B in 2021.

Bridges, broadband, consuming water techniques, hazardous waste therapy, inland waterways, public parks and strong waste acquired grades of C+, C or C–, reserved for infrastructure that’s in mediocre situation and wishes consideration. Dams, levees, roads, colleges and infrastructure for aviation, power, storm water, transit and wastewater acquired grades of D+ or D, indicating that they’re in poor situation.

Some aviation infrastructure is broadly thought of outdated, and the Federal Aviation Administration has confronted a scarcity of air site visitors controllers for years. Vitality was the one class moreover rail that acquired a declining grade, to D+. The group stated energy crops and different sources of electrical energy had did not sustain with rising demand from electrical autos and synthetic intelligence.

“Every knowledge heart makes use of the identical quantity of power wanted to energy 80,000 properties,” stated Otto Lynch, an engineer who led the power chapter of the report. “Our technology capability has remained stagnant as new sources are merely changing sources like coal which have been retired in recent times.”
